NdisMDeregisterDmaChannel, fonction (ndis.h)

La fonction NdisMDeregisterDmaChannel libère la revendication d’un pilote miniport sur un canal DMA pour une carte réseau.

Syntaxe

void NdisMDeregisterDmaChannel(
  [in] NDIS_HANDLE MiniportDmaHandle
);

Paramètres

[in] MiniportDmaHandle

Handle DMA retourné par le Fonction NdisMRegisterDmaChannel .

Valeur de retour

None

Remarques

L’appelant doit considérer MiniportDmaHandle non valide dès qu’il est passé à NdisMDeregisterDmaChannel. Cette fonction libère la revendication de la carte réseau sur le canal DMA dans le Registre.

NdisMDeregisterDmaChannel peut être appelé uniquement à partir des fonctions MiniportInitializeEx et MiniportHaltEx d’un pilote miniport.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Pris en charge pour les pilotes NDIS 6.0 et NDIS 5.1 (consultez NdisMDeregisterDmaChannel (NDIS 5.1)) dans Windows Vista. Pris en charge pour les pilotes NDIS 5.1 (consultez NdisMDeregisterDmaChannel (NDIS 5.1)) dans Windows XP.
Plateforme cible Universal
En-tête ndis.h (inclure Ndis.h)
Bibliothèque Ndis.lib
IRQL PASSIVE_LEVEL
Règles de conformité DDI Irql_Miniport_Driver_Function(ndis)

Voir aussi

MiniportHaltEx

MiniportInitializeEx

NdisMRegisterDmaChannel